Description
At GSA, we specialize in the design and manufacture of high-quality wire harness assemblies that serve the automotive, aerospace, and industrial sectors. We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Manufacturing Engineer to optimize our wire harness assembly processes and support production excellence.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op, maintain, and optimize wire harness assembly processes, work instructions, and documentation.
- Support design-to-production transitions by reviewing schematics and ensuring manufacturability.
- Define tooling, equipment, and materials requirements for harness production.
- Provide on-floor assistance to manufacturing technicians during assembly and troubleshooting.
- Establish and refine assembly sequences and jigs for consistent quality and efficiency.
- Lead root cause analysis and implement corrective actions for quality issues.
- Develop and oversee testing protocols for wire harness assemblies.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ams including design, quality, and supply chain to drive continuous improvement.
Requirements
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Electrical, Mechanical, or related Engineering field or equivalent experience.
- 3+ years in wire harness or cable assembly manufacturing engineering, preferably in aerospace, automotive, or defense industries.
- Proficiency with electrical schematics and CAD tools (CATIA, Creo, SolidWorks) preferred.
- Experience with industry standards such as IPC/WHMA-A-620.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
- Ability to lead process improvements and support teams on the floor.
- Fluent in English required; fluency in spanish &/or Vietnamese also helpful.
